Add 3/14 and 98/90
1st number: 3/14, 2nd number: 1 8/90
3/14 + 98/90 is 821/630.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 90 is 630
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 630 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 45 = 630,
3/14 = 3 × 45/14 × 45 = 135/630 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 90 × 7 = 630,
98/90 = 98 × 7/90 × 7 = 686/630 - Add the two like fractions:
135/630 + 686/630 = 135 + 686/630 = 821/630 - So, 3/14 + 98/90 = 821/630
